Your basement could be an underutilized space. However, with some creativity and effort, you can transform it into a functional area that fulfills your needs. Begin with considering what you want to achieve the space for. Are you need an extra bedroom, a home office, or a recreational area? Once you have a clear vision, you can start planning the structure.

  • Think about the existing elements of your basement, such as ceiling height, windows, and electrical outlets.
  • Draft a layout that maximizes space and fits all your desired features.
  • Opt for resistant materials that can withstand the dampness common in basements.

Through careful planning and execution, you can convert your basement into a functional space that enhances the overall value and usefulness of your home.

Basement Finishing: Ideas to elevate Your Living Area

Unleashing the potential of your basement can transform it into a functional and inviting space. Consider finishing your basement for a home office, entertainment area, or guest suite. Adding natural light with windows or skylights can make the space feel brighter and more welcoming.

A well-planned layout with an open floor plan can boost the flow and create a spacious atmosphere. Remember add comfortable seating, adequate lighting, and area rugs to define different zones within your basement.

With inspired design choices, you can upgrade your basement into a valuable extension of your home.
